Visual Indicators of Termite Invasion



If you discover small piles of what resembles sawdust near wood structures in your house, you may be seeing the first aesthetic indicators of a termite infestation. Termites, usually described as the 'quiet destroyers,' can damage your building without you even recognizing it. These tiny heaps are really termite droppings, referred to as frass, which are a byproduct of their tunneling activities within the timber.

As you evaluate your home for signs of termites, pay attention to any mud tubes running along the walls or foundation. These tubes act as protective passages for termites to take a trip in between their nest and a food source without drying out. Structural Changes Triggered By Termites



Pay attention very closely for any signs of hollow-sounding or deteriorated timber in your house, as these architectural adjustments might suggest a termite problem. Termites feed on timber from the inside out, leaving a slim veneer of hardwood or paint on the surface while hollowing out the within. This can result in timber that appears hollow when tapped or really feels soft and deteriorated.

Furthermore, you may observe buckling or sagging floorings, doors that no longer close appropriately, or windows that are instantly tough to open up. These adjustments take place as termites damage the structural stability of wood elements in your home. Watch out for tiny holes in timber, as these could be termite leave factors where they push out fecal pellets.
